You need all types of fitness.

Fitness isn’t all about how far you can run. It isn’t about our strength or whether you can touch your toes. It’s all those things and more. It’s about feeling good and getting the most out of life. There are four types of fitness, endurance, strength, balance, and flexibility. To be truly healthy you have to be fit in all those areas. That’s why it takes a well-rounded program. You’ll probably be better in one area over another, but you should be fit in every type. If you hate running, you don’t have to do it for cardio. You can go dancing or swimming. There are many ways to boost your cardiovascular endurance with one of them perfect for you.
